What I saw recently suggests that 17% of Londoners have the antibodies suggesting that they already had coronavirus.
Outside London the figure is 5%.
Herd immunity will take ages because they need 60-80% of us to have had it first and they can't ignore the lockdown because the NHS would collapse.
Given what we have had to put up with thus far I am not sure people will put up with it for a long period of time in order to achieve 60-80% immunity.
